THE STATE OF MAHARASHTRA THROUGH SECRETARY AND OTHERS Mr.A.A.Mukhedkar, Advocate for the petitioners. Ms.S.S.Joshi, AGP for the respondent/State.
Mr. S.B. Pulkundwar, Advocate for respondent No.3. ( CORAM : MANGESH S. PATIL AND PRAFULLA S. KHUBALKAR, JJ. ) DATE : FEBRUARY 3, 2025 PER COURT :
1.
The petitioner/school is seeking reimbursement u/s 12 of the Right of Children to Free and Compulsory Education Act, 2009.
2.
The writ petition is disposed of with a direction to the respondents to examine the petitioners' proposal/claim on its own merits, as expeditiously as possible and in any case within 6 weeks.
3.
If and to the extent the petitioners are found entitled to receive the reimbursement, that shall be disbursed within 6 weeks thereafter.
